What DSI LED Continuous means on a Viking range

The DSI LED Continuous fault on a Viking range indicates a problem within the Direct Spark Ignition control system. In normal operation, the DSI control module manages the ignition sequence for the gas burner: it sends voltage to the spark igniter, monitors the flame sensor for confirmation of ignition, and then holds the gas valve open once flame is proven. When the DSI status LED remains on continuously rather than cycling or extinguishing after a successful ignition attempt, the module has detected an internal or circuit-level fault that prevents it from completing or maintaining this sequence correctly.

The most common root cause is a failed DSI control board itself. The module contains internal logic circuits and sensing components that can degrade over time due to heat exposure, voltage spikes, or age-related component failure. A continuous LED state, as opposed to a flashing pattern, typically signals that the board has entered a locked-out or faulted state from which it cannot recover on its own. This is distinct from ignition lockout faults caused by external components like a dirty flame sensor or faulty igniter, which usually present with different LED behavior.

The recommended first diagnostic step is a power cycle: disconnect the range from power for at least 30 seconds, then restore power and attempt ignition again. This clears any transient fault that may have triggered the lockout. If the LED returns to a continuous-on state after the power cycle and retry, the DSI control module itself is the identified failed component and requires replacement. External wiring connections to the board should also be inspected for loose pins or heat damage before condemning the board.

Common causes of DSI LED Continuous

  1. 01

    Failed DSI control board

    Part replacement

    Internal component failure within the Direct Spark Ignition module is the most likely cause when the LED stays on continuously after a power cycle. The board's logic circuitry has entered a fault state it cannot exit, requiring board replacement.

  2. 02

    Transient power or voltage fault

    Wiring / connection

    A momentary power surge or voltage irregularity can cause the DSI module to lock out and display a continuous LED. A full power cycle of at least 30 seconds is the first step to clear this type of fault.

  3. 03

    Loose or damaged wiring connections to DSI board

    Wiring / connection

    Connector pins or wiring harness terminals at the DSI board can loosen or suffer heat damage over time, causing the board to misread circuit conditions and fault. Inspect all connections to the module before replacing the board.

  4. 04

    Short circuit in igniter or valve circuit

    Wiring / connection

    A short in the wiring leading to the spark igniter or gas valve can cause the DSI control to fault and latch the LED on. Check the continuity and insulation integrity of these circuits with a multimeter.

  5. 05

    Flame sensor circuit fault

    Wiring / connection

    If the flame sensing circuit is open or shorted, the DSI board may interpret the condition as an unrecoverable fault rather than a simple ignition failure. Inspect the sensor wiring and sensor rod for damage or corrosion.

Frequently asked questions about DSI LED Continuous

What does DSI LED Continuous mean on a Viking range?
DSI LED Continuous means the Direct Spark Ignition control board has detected a fault and its status LED is staying on solid rather than cycling normally. The DSI board manages the gas ignition sequence, and a continuous LED indicates the board has entered a locked-out fault state. This fault requires a power cycle as a first diagnostic step, and if it persists, the DSI board itself likely needs to be replaced.
Will resetting the power clear the DSI LED Continuous fault on a Viking range?
A power cycle is always the first recommended step: disconnect the range from power for at least 30 seconds, restore power, and retry ignition. If the fault was caused by a transient voltage event or a temporary error, the reset may clear it completely. However, if the LED returns to a continuous-on state after the power cycle, the DSI control board has an internal failure and a reset will not resolve it permanently.
Is it safe to use my Viking range when the DSI LED Continuous fault is active?
When the DSI board is in a faulted state, the ignition control system is not operating correctly, which means the gas ignition sequence may not complete safely or reliably. It is best to avoid using the affected burner until the fault is diagnosed and resolved. Attempting to operate a burner when the ignition system is compromised can pose a safety risk.
How do I fix the DSI LED Continuous fault on my Viking range?
Start by cycling the power to the range for at least 30 seconds, then restore power and attempt to use the burner again. If the fault clears, no further action is needed. If the LED remains on continuously, inspect all wiring connections to the DSI board for looseness or heat damage, and check the igniter and flame sensor circuits for shorts or open conditions. If no wiring issue is found, the DSI control board requires replacement.
How much does it cost to replace a DSI control board on a Viking range?
The cost to replace a DSI control board on a Viking range typically falls in the range of $150 to $400 or more for the part alone, depending on the specific model. Adding professional labor costs can bring the total repair to $250 to $600 or higher. Obtaining a model-specific part quote before scheduling service is recommended, as Viking replacement components can vary significantly in price.
